Web16 feb. 2024 · As the region is named after the Caribs (pronounced kar-ib), the technically accurate pronunciation of the word "Caribbean" is "Kar-i-bee-in." However, many people (some Caribbean natives included) prefer the pronunciation "Ka-RIB-ee-in," and so both dictions are relatively commonplace. Web11 apr. 2024 · Coño is a common, somewhat vulgar Spanish idiom primarily used in Spain and the Spanish Caribbean. Its actual meaning differs according to use, but in Spain and several Latin American countries it is also used in its literal sense as slang for the female genitalia, the vulva . Coño has become a feature of speech to express emphasis or to ... WebI tried to read about it... It seems the phoneme is represented by [ʝ], but can also be pronounced [ɟ͡ʝ] and [d͡ʒo̞]. Most Spanish speakers say it depends on dialect, but some places say it can vary with the position, like [ʝ] is more likely to be used between vowels, and [ɟ͡ʝ] and [d͡ʒo̞] are used at the start of a sentence or after a nasal consonant like N. Web11 aug. 2024 · 10. Bola. Bola literally means “ball,” but in Cuban slang it’s a noun meaning “gossip,” similar to saying “the word on the street.”. La bola es que el profesor de español nunca se casó. The word on the street is that the Spanish teacher never got married. You might like: Chismeando: How to Spread Gossip in Spanish. 11.
